Electronics Technician III
Lewis Energy Group
Overview Summary Lays out, rigs up, builds, tests, troubleshoots, repairs and modifies oilfield production electronic components, parts, equipment, and systems, such as computer equipment, data acquisition instrumentation, flow tubes, densitometers, pressure transducers, test equipment, and other various hydraulic fracturing machinery and controls, applying principles and theories of electronics, electrical circuitry, mathematics, electronic and electrical testing. Responsibilities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following (Additional duties may be assigned as necessary): Troubleshoots, repairs and calibrates sensors at an entry to intermediate level, to include but not limited to: pressure, temperature, speed, density, viscosity, pH, level position, float, counting devices, hydraulic control, photo cells, flow rate, differential pressure, pressure switches under the direction and guidance of the Lead Electronics Technician and/or Supervisor. Performs use of Data Van control software to include: installation, configuration, and remote usage, pull and analyze log data files and configuration files from a Data Van or other unit. Assists other electronics personnel on equipment capabilities and usage to include Data Van software. Performs tracking and accountability of repair parts, ready spares and consumables. Communicates equipment status details and directions in a clear and coherent manner. Maintains daily work logs, paperwork requirements, and work orders on a timely and efficient basis. Coordinates with appropriate personnel in regards to completing work requests, troubleshooting and upgrading equipment. Coordinates with other technicians and Lead personnel regarding equipment status, emergency repairs and best practices of equipment usage. Displays knowledge of circuits, systems and components utilized on the fracturing equipment. Analyzes and modifies standard circuitry to improve its performance. Performs maintenance of computer systems including software and hardware updates. Completes preventive maintenance and visual inspections using authorized procedures, preventive maintenance forms, and reporting media. Reads, comprehends, and interprets blueprints/drawings, schematics, and procedures and relates them to the facility/equipment and have the ability to troubleshoot non-standard electronic devices or devices for which documentation is incomplete or not available. Sets up and runs tests with occasional supervisory and/or engineering support. Performs failure analysis and communicates findings effectively using standalone reports and/or other software. Education and/or Experience High school diploma or general education degree (GED) and one year certificate from college or technical school; or one to three years related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ience. Language Skills Ability to read, analyze, and interpret documents such as safety guidelines, operational and maintenance instructions, technical procedures, and governmental regulations. Ability to write reports and business correspondence. Ability to speak effectively, present information and respond to questions from supervisors, managers, and clients. Mathematical Skills Ability to add, subtract, multiply, and divide in all units of measure, using whole numbers, common fractions, and decimals. Ability to apply concepts of basic algebra and geometry. Ability to use mathematical formulas to compute rate, ratio, and percent and to draw and interpret bar graphs. Reasoning Ability Ability to solve practical problems and deal with a variety of concrete variables in situations where only limited standardization exists. Ability to interpret a variety of instructions furnished in written, oral, diagram, or schedule form. Computer Skills Familiar with Microsoft Programs, Database management, basic communications and networking protocols. Web and Cloud services knowledge a plus. Certificates, Licenses, Registrations Valid driver's license with a satisfactory driving record. Other Skills and Abilities Professional, clear verbal and written communication skills. Ability to work flexible schedule, including long and/or irregular hours. Ability to work in remote locations. Ability to read equipment prints and schematics to perform effective troubleshooting. Ability to work autonomously with minimal supervision and meet strict deadlines. Ability to read and write minimal English for safety reasons. Must own a set of basic tools. Bilingual is a plus. Other Qualifications Basic knowledge and at least one year of experience in maintenance and repair of instrumentation including but not limited to: flow meters, transducers, densitometers, PLCs and other measurement controls. Knowledge of a wide variety of electronic test equipment and various mechanical hand tools. Knowledge and ability to solder simple circuits, connectors, and wiring.
